Animal Waste Management Computer Program

What AWM DoesAWM is a planning/design tool for animal feeding operations that can be used to estimate the production of manure, bedding, process water and determine the size of storage/treatment facilities. The procedures and calculations used in AWM are based on the USDA-NRCS Agricultural Waste Management Field Handbook.AWM uses the concepts of “Manure Master” to produce a gross nutrient balance but does not track mass or concentration of nutrients for determining land application rates or for other utilization components.

Page 53: Animal Waste Management Software CNMP Core Curriculum Section 4 — Manure and Wastewater Storage and Handling

Animal Waste Management Computer ProgramDesign Screens

Enter the permeability of the soil to be used for the liner. This value is normally available from the soil mechanics report.

Click on “Include Soil Liner” to access the soil liner design screen.

Enter the allowable specific discharge. This value may be based on regulatory requirements.

Click on the calculator symbol to access the conversion calculator. The calculator can be used to convert centimeters per second to feet per day.

Page 61: Animal Waste Management Software CNMP Core Curriculum Section 4 — Manure and Wastewater Storage and Handling

Animal Waste Management Computer ProgramDesign Screens AWM computed

dimensions for the example shown.

Click on drop-down list to select the shape of the lagoon to base the design on. Choices are rectangular and circular.

Click on drop-down list to select Bottom Width or Bottom Length dimension to base the design on.

Vary depth and bottom width to accommodate the site.

The NRCS design methodology is used unless the “Use Rational Design Method” box is checked.

Enter the number of years for sludge accumulation. At least 1 year of sludge accumulation period should be entered to account for sludge buildup in the lagoon.
